Ivan Varfolomeyev (Ukrainian: Іван Олександрович Варфоломєєв; born 24 March 2004) is a Ukrainian professional footballer who plays as a defensive midfielder for EFL League One club Lincoln City.[2]

Career

[edit]

Born in Simferopol, Varfolomeyev is a product of the SC Tavriya Simferopol, where his first trainers were Andriy Cheremysin and Vitaliy Ponomaryov, and Karpaty Lviv youth sportive systems.[3]

In September 2020, he transferred to Rukh Lviv and made his Ukrainian Premier League debut as a second-half substitute against Shakhtar Donetsk on 21 February 2021.[4]

Varfolomeyev joined Czech First League club Slovan Liberec in June 2022.[5] In January 2025, he signed a new contract until the summer of 2028.[6]

On 21 August 2025, Varfolomeyev joined English League One club Lincoln City for an undisclosed fee, believed to be for £350,000 which would surpass the club's previous record fee paid for John Akinde in 2018.[7] He agreed a four-year contract with The Imps, with Slovan Liberec confirming they retained a large share in his next transfer.[8][9] He made his debut for Lincoln City in the EFL Cup starting the game against Burton Albion on the 26 August 2025.[10] The following game he would make his League One debut coming off the bench in a 1–1 draw against Mansfield Town.[11]
